[Ajuda] Erros de Include do PPC_Trucking - Printable Version
+- SA-MP Forums Archive (
https://sampforum.blast.hk)
+-- Forum: Non-English (
https://sampforum.blast.hk/forumdisplay.php?fid=9)
+--- Forum: Languages (
https://sampforum.blast.hk/forumdisplay.php?fid=33)
+---- Forum: Português/Portuguese (
https://sampforum.blast.hk/forumdisplay.php?fid=34)
+---- Thread: [Ajuda] Erros de Include do PPC_Trucking (
/showthread.php?tid=540958)
Erros de Include do PPC_Trucking -
PedexM - 08.10.2014
PHP код:
C:\Users\Graзa Portela\Desktop\Jogos\GTA\Samps\PPC_Trucking\pawno\include\PPC_Common.inc(263) : error 017: undefined symbol "Cam3DText"
C:\Users\Graзa Portela\Desktop\Jogos\GTA\Samps\PPC_Trucking\pawno\include\PPC_Common.inc(263) : warning 213: tag mismatch
C:\Users\Graзa Portela\Desktop\Jogos\GTA\Samps\PPC_Trucking\pawno\include\PPC_Common.inc(266) : error 017: undefined symbol "CamObj3"
C:\Users\Graзa Portela\Desktop\Jogos\GTA\Samps\PPC_Trucking\pawno\include\PPC_Common.inc(407) : error 017: undefined symbol "RandomBonusxD"
C:\Users\Graзa Portela\Desktop\Jogos\GTA\Samps\PPC_Trucking\pawno\include\PPC_Common.inc(407) : error 029: invalid expression, assumed zero
C:\Users\Graзa Portela\Desktop\Jogos\GTA\Samps\PPC_Trucking\pawno\include\PPC_Common.inc(407) : error 029: invalid expression, assumed zero
C:\Users\Graзa Portela\Desktop\Jogos\GTA\Samps\PPC_Trucking\pawno\include\PPC_Common.inc(407) : fatal error 107: too many error messages on one line
LINHAS DOS PPC_COMMONS
Linha de 251 a 267
PHP код:
// This function creates a speedcamera (store data and create the objects)
SetupSpeedCamera(CamID, Float:x, Float:y, Float:z, Float:rot, MaxSpeed)
{
// Store all the given values
ACameras[CamID][CamX] = x;
ACameras[CamID][CamY] = y;
ACameras[CamID][CamZ] = z;
ACameras[CamID][CamAngle] = rot;
ACameras[CamID][CamSpeed] = MaxSpeed;
// Create both camera objects and store their reference
new JS_TEXTO[256];
format(JS_TEXTO, sizeof(JS_TEXTO), "{FF0000}[RADAR] \nVel. Mбxima {FFFF00}%i {FF0000}Km/h ",MaxSpeed);
ACameras[CamID][Cam3DText] = CreateDynamic3DTextLabel(JS_TEXTO,-1,x,y,z +5.0,100.0);
ACameras[CamID][CamObj1] = CreateObject(18880, x, y, z, 0.0, 0.0, rot);
ACameras[CamID][CamObj2] = CreateObject(18880, x, y, z, 0.0, 0.0, rot + 180.0);
ACameras[CamID][CamObj3] = CreateDynamicMapIcon(x, y, z, 34, 0, 0, 0, -1, 300.0);
}
Linhas de 403 a 457
PHP код:
forward ShowRandomBonusMafia();
public ShowRandomBonusMafia()
{
new bool:MissionSet = false, Msg1[1000], lName[1000], sName[1000], eName[1000], tName[1000];
if ((RandomBonusxD[RandomLoad] == 0) || (RandomBonusxD[MissionFinishedxD] == true))
{
while (MissionSet == false)
{
RandomBonusxD[RandomLoad] = random(sizeof(ALoads));
switch (RandomBonusxD[RandomLoad])
{
case 0: MissionSet = false;
default:
{
switch(ALoads[RandomBonusxD[RandomLoad]][PCV_Required])
{
case PCV_MafiaVan:
{
MissionSet = true;
}
default: MissionSet = false;
}
}
}
}
RandomBonusxD[RandomStartLoc] = Product_GetRandomStartLoc(RandomBonusxD[RandomLoad]);
RandomBonusxD[RandomEndLoc] = Product_GetRandomEndLoc(RandomBonusxD[RandomLoad]);
RandomBonusxD[MissionFinishedxD] = false;
}
format(lName, 50, ALoads[RandomBonusxD[RandomLoad]][LoadName]);
format(sName, 50, ALocations[RandomBonusxD[RandomStartLoc]][LocationName]);
format(eName, 50, ALocations[RandomBonusxD[RandomEndLoc]][LocationName]);
switch(ALoads[RandomBonusxD[RandomLoad]][PCV_Required])
{
case PCV_MafiaVan: format(tName, 128, "SandKing");
case PCV_MafiaVanxD: format(tName, 128, "MoonBeam");
}
format(Msg1, 1000, "{D683C7}[Bфnus Mafia]: Transportar %s, de %s para %s com %s", lName, sName, eName, tName);
for (new playerid; playerid < MAX_PLAYERS; playerid++)
{
if (APlayerData[playerid][LoggedIn] == true)
{
if (APlayerData[playerid][PlayerClass] == ClassMafia)
{
SendClientMessage(playerid, 0xFFFFFFFF, Msg1);
}
}
}
return 1;
}
Re: Erros de Include do PPC_Trucking -
iAbsolut - 08.10.2014
tenta ir em PPC_Defines, procura por TSpeedCamera, e coloca isso:
pawn Код:
Float:CamX,
Float:CamY,
Float:CamZ,
Float:CamAngle,
CamSpeed,
CamObj1,
CamObj2,
CamObj3,
Text3D:Cam3DText
#EDIT
Nгo tinha visto o outro, viajei
Ainda em PPC_Defines, procura por RandomBonusMission, e cola isso em baixo dele:
pawn Код:
enum TRandomBonusxD
{
RandomLoad,
RandomStartLoc,
RandomEndLoc,
bool:MissionFinishedxD
}
new RandomBonusxD[TRandomBonusxD];